Info


target=”_blank”>http://www.youtube.com/watch?v=c0TpDxLfjHc

“Here’s footage of the Loch Ness monster, live in Tokyo! For the film “The Water Horse: Legend of the Deep” was a 18 meter high monster in the Tokyo Bay projected. These were “special effect projectors & pumps, which according to the water receded into the light. Music & Sound effects were obviously not lacking. Disney World Technology Meets Guerilla Marketing”…

via blissblog

Nessie was originally published on The Curious Brain

Comments

No comments yet.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.